Topic: No More Thorns
Scripture: Luke 10:38-42
In the parable of the sower, Jesus talked about seeds that fell among thorns. There would have been a great harvest except that the presence of the thorns choked the seed. The seed is the Word of God. The thorns are the things we worry about; the cares of the world. So, in essence, by worrying, you choke the manifestation of God’s Word in your life.
Martha and Mary had the opportunity and privilege to host Jesus in their home. But unfortunately for Martha, thorns began to creep into her heart. She became worried about all that needed to be done, and she was upset at Mary, who was just focused on Jesus. It looked like her worrying was righteous because it was about hosting Jesus. But it was simply a thorn robbing her of the blessing of the moment.
There is no blessing in worrying or being afraid, even if it is for a godly cause. The blessing of the moment went to Mary because she knew how to focus on Jesus rather than the activity. There is a place for activity, but it must never be at the expense of our communion with Him. Whenever you focus on Jesus, you encounter the peace that will uproot every thorn. Your harvest is here. No more thorns.
Meditation: Are you like Martha, filled with worry and burdened with pressure? Or are you like Mary, who knew how to find peace in His presence? There is grace released by your Father to help you uproot every thorn in your heart so you can see the manifestation of His word.
